Background:

2S seed storage protein 3, one of major seed storage proteins is synthesized on the endoplasmic reticulum as precursor and then transported to storage vacuoles, where it is processed by an asparaginyl endopeptidase to produce two mature polypeptides referred to as large and small subunits which are linked by disulfide bonds

 

Subcellular location: Vacuole
